THE CAR’S exterior catches the eyes first and is one of the top considerat­ions when choosing a vehicle model, but the interiors of the car is also a key factor to achieve utmost luxury and comfort for both drivers and passengers.

A cabin, geared with extravagan­t technologi­es, confuses and distracts the driver to focus on what matters most — driving. Car seats up to the control buttons need to be positioned strategica­lly to have a serene ride experience.

Nowadays, tablet- style touch screens, optical displays and voice commands are integrated into the car’s interior. Car designers harmonize the form and function of the key components in the cockpit, not just for the sake of looks, but also for functional­ity and practicabi­lity. To give you concrete examples, here is a list of some cars crafted with appealing and smart interiors. — America’s legendary pony car, Ford Mustang, features an interior design that offers maximum comfort and advanced technology. The sporty driver’s seat is set low and sleek, positioned carefully to control the gear stick, steering wheel and other components with great ease.

Its hot look is complement­ed with cool technology that offers modern convenienc­es from starting the engine to playing the latest tunes in a playlist. Keyless Entry and Push-button Start allows the driver get into and start the vehicle with less effort. Meanwhile, the voice-activated SYNC with MyFord Touch, a wireless technology to pass informatio­n between phone and vehicle, allows hands-free calls and music streaming through simple voice commands.

In addition, the Ford Mustang is engineered with sophistica­ted handling technologi­es that help the driver maintains complete control even from sudden maneuvers, heavy traffic, as well as challengin­g road and weather conditions.
